Estate agent ‘is takeover target’
Countrywide, the owner of estate agent chains Hamptons and Bairstow Eves, is being sized up for a bid by a mystery suitor, according to a Mail on Sunday report.
The company floated on a valuation of £750m six years ago but has slumped to a market capitalisation of only £77m amid a tough property market.
Countrywide was previously owned by the private equity giant Apollo before falling into the hands of its lenders in the wake of the credit crunch. The company, led by executive chairman Peter Long, made no comment.
